<DIV dir=ltr align=left><SPAN class=715274623-24092022>I use silvered mica for
VCOs and VCFs, typically 390pF or 500pF. They work very well. They
are typically big brown things that are kinda lumpy.</SPAN></DIV>
<DIV dir=ltr align=left><SPAN class=715274623-24092022></SPAN> </DIV>
<DIV dir=ltr align=left><SPAN class=715274623-24092022>You have to be careful
with some types of caps, such as polystyrene, because they are easily damaged or
destroyed when soldering. Not sure about polypropylene. Silvered
mica and metallized polyester are pretty forgiving.</SPAN></DIV><BR>
